executeBatchDetailed returning update count 0

I am using Oracle 9i database and iBATIS 2.3.0. 

Here is my code

             sqlMapper.startTransaction();
             parameterMap.put("sequenceList", sequences);
             parameterMap.put("status", newStatus);
             sqlMapper.startBatch ();
             sqlMapper.update("updateStatus", parameterMap);

             List batchResultList = sqlMapper.executeBatchDetailed();
             for(int i=0; i<batchResultList.size();i++)
             {
                logger.debug("UpdatedStatus : " + i + " " + 
batchResultList.get(i));    // this gives me 0 count even though 2 records 
get updated
             } 
             sqlMapper.commitTransaction();


According to this url:
http://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/IBATIS-159

this problem has been fix since iBATIS 2.2.0. But its still not returning 
updated records counts.
